Fazlullah says he is not against media freedom |
2009-05-01 |
![]() Talking to local media persons by phone from an undisclosed location on Wednesday, the TTS chief said: "I believe in freedom of the media and distribution of pamphlets in Swat was not meant to threaten journalists. It was an appeal to counter conspiracies of the anti-Islam forces through their pen." The journalists are free to work in the district, he added. He said journalists should report events objectively and that they had no intention to put curb on them. The journalists of Swat should continue with their fact-based reporting without any fear, he said. |
